Job Summary

As a Senior Real Estate Appraiser within the Valuation Services Group, you will bring your expertise and knowledge to a team that specializes in multifamily and commercial appraisal assignments, with a strong emphasis on multifamily product ranging from 5 to 500 units. We are dedicated to helping real estate appraisal professionals grow with our team. You will be provided all the equipment, training, data sources and software for real estate appraisers who have an eagerness and passion for ensuring that appraisal reports meet our strong quality assurance standards. In this position we will provide you with hands-on real estate experience that will prepare you for a variety of real estate related roles within the firm.

Job Responsibilities

  • Appraise 5+ unit multifamily residential, mixed use and/or commercial properties to estimate the market value for related financial transactions in accordance with internal policies/procedures, industry standards and regulatory requirements (USPAP & FIRREA).
  • Interview real estate market participants for rent surveys, sales surveys and subject property analysis.
  • Manage time efficiently to meet service level deadlines.
  • Understand various building construction types, flood/environmental hazards, earthquake and zoning conditions (as pertinent).
  • Learn and perform the administrative tasks that drive the CRE Appraisal process.
  • Utilize risk-based decisions, work with stakeholders to ensure that appraisal reports are complete, accurate, credible, relevant, and reasonable based on sound real estate appraisal methodology.

Required qualifications, capabilities and skills

  • Minimum a 4-year college degree.
  • A State Certified General Appraiser License 
  • Minimum 3 years of experience appraising multifamily residential, mixed-use and/or commercial properties.
  • Strong analytical, business writing and oral communication skills.
  • Strong critical thinking and problem solving.
  • Computer/technology knowledge as well as a proficiency in MS Word, Excel and Outlook (Microsoft Office Suite).
  • Deep knowledge of local real estate market trends and neighborhoods.
  • Continual development of local market knowledge and national real estate trends is required .

Preferred qualifications, capabilities and skills

  • Discounted Cash Flow programs knowledge and methodologies.
  • Experience appraising for financial Institutions.
